A Standardized Spec: Fostering Competition and Innovation

Unlike MotoGP's free-for-all approach to engine technology, Moto2 embraces a standardized engine specification. This crucial decision levels the playing field, shifting the focus from raw engine power to chassis dynamics, rider skill, and strategic tire management. This standardization, achieved through the use of a single-manufacturer engine, the Triumph 765cc triple, has proven incredibly effective. It ensures that victories are earned through superior riding and team strategy, not simply through superior financial resources allowing for the development of the most powerful engine.

The Triumph 765cc Engine: A Heart of Innovation

The selection of the Triumph 765cc engine marked a significant step for Moto2. The inline-triple configuration provides a unique power delivery compared to other engine types, demanding a specific riding style and forcing teams to optimize their chassis and setup accordingly. This engine, based on the street-legal Triumph Street Triple RS, has undergone significant modifications to meet the demands of racing, highlighting the impressive adaptability and potential of this platform. Its reliability and consistent performance have been instrumental in the success of the Moto2 class.

Chassis Development: Pushing the Boundaries of Performance

With the engine standardized, teams can concentrate their engineering expertise on optimizing the chassis. This has led to incredible advancements in areas such as:

  • Aerodynamics: Teams constantly refine fairings and other aerodynamic components to minimize drag and maximize downforce, enhancing stability at high speeds and cornering performance. The development of winglets and other aerodynamic aids has become a key area of competition within the Moto2 class.

  • Suspension Technology: Sophisticated suspension systems, employing cutting-edge materials and designs, allow riders to maintain optimal grip and control even during the most demanding corners and track conditions. The constant pursuit of improved suspension performance is a defining characteristic of Moto2 competition.

  • Electronics: While not as complex as MotoGP, Moto2 utilizes advanced electronics including traction control, launch control, and sophisticated data acquisition systems. These systems play a vital role in optimizing performance and rider safety.

The Impact on Rider Development

The standardized engine in Moto2 serves as a crucial stepping stone for aspiring MotoGP riders. The focus on chassis setup, rider skill, and strategic racecraft prepares them for the intense competition and technological demands of the premier class. Many current MotoGP stars honed their skills and raced in Moto2.
